Prepare the Surface


Cracking or breaking will leave an unequal surface which may make the repair service tough to carry out. You can sand the surface area with a 400 to 600-grit great sandpaper. This can additionally be done to the cracked component. The fining sand procedure boosts call and also adherence with the loading product.

Fixing Substance Application


These consist of epoxy putty, epoxy adhesive, or various other porcelain filler. The filling up products are normally added in layers with periodic sanding in between each application. It is best to let each coat dry before topping it. Making use of filling products comes in helpful when the chip is deep. Loading till just a little above the surface of the sink permits you to file down to its degree. When still in belongings of the busted piece, the epoxy glue can be found in useful. Sand the surface areas Buy Now gently, then clean them prior to gluing. Apply the glue to both surface areas and push the broken piece back right into placement. Finally, rub out the excess adhesive.

Evaluate the Degree of Damages to The Sink


Because your sink is still most likely being used, you need to clean it with water, a sponge, and also an all-purpose cleaner to remove dirt and residue. Next, observe the nature as well as degree of the damages plainly. There are 2 significant sort of washroom sinks; the strong porcelain or ceramic kind and also the actors iron kind with ceramic or porcelain overlay. The damages with the last subjects the inner cast iron to wetness as well as air, resulting in rust that could satin the overlay. In this case, the repair requires to be impacted promptly to stop rusting and also additional damage. For solid ceramic sinks, epoxy adhesive or various other repair service substances normally function fine.

Cracked in Fireclay Sink: How to Repair?


Examining the Size of the Crack


Examining the size of the crack/damage helps you validate the necessary tools to use.



If the damage is extensive, you will require additional tools like the porcelain reinforcement kit and tile adhesive compound.


Cleaning the Sink


First, use hot water and dish soap to clean the sink’s surface thoroughly. Next, rinse the sink with enough water to expose the cracks. After the sink is dry, you will physically notice all the cracks that should be fixed.


Sanding the Affected Spots


Gently scrub the sink surface using 180-grit sandpaper. Take precautions not to apply excess pressure and damage the rest of the surface. Use a tack cloth to get rid of the tinny fireclay and enamel particles from the surface of the sink after you finish sanding.


Apply Epoxy or Porc-A-Fix Putty Along the Crack


Epoxy putty is a repair compound and a gap-filling solution for porcelain sinks and fireclay fixtures. This particular compound blends precisely with the surface of the sink to create a spotless finish.


  • Using a spatula, spread enough amount of epoxy putty along the crack to fill it.


  • Smooth the putty to create an even finish


  • Leave the putty to dry/cure naturally (this should take approximately an hour)


  • Sanding the Sink after Repairing


    Once you finish filling the crack, use the 180-grit or 200-grit sanding paper to smoothen the sink surface.


    Polish or Re-gloss the Sink Surface


    Polishing or waxing the sink after you finish the repair is optional.
